Method

Beef & Veggie Base

  1. 1

    Cook aromatics

    Heat a large skillet over medium heat. Add olive oil. When shimmering, add diced yellow onion, red and green bell peppers, and a pinch of salt. Sauté, stirring occasionally, until onions are translucent and peppers soften, about 5–6 minutes. Add minced jalapeño and garlic and cook 30–45 seconds until fragrant.

  2. 2

    Brown the beef

    Increase heat to medium-high. Push vegetables to the side and add ground beef to the skillet. Break it up with a spatula and cook until no pink remains, about 6–8 minutes. Drain excess fat if there is more than a tablespoon.

  3. 3

    Season beef

    Return skillet to medium heat if needed. Sprinkle in ground cumin, chili powder, salt, and black pepper. Stir to combine thoroughly and cook another 1–2 minutes to bloom the spices.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Remove from heat and set aside.

Creamy & Salsa Layer

  1. 4

    While the beef finishes, soften the cream cheese if not already softened: microwave in 10-second bursts or let sit at room temperature. In a medium bowl, beat the cream cheese until smooth using a spatula or electric mixer. Stir in sour cream until uniform. Fold in the cream-style salsa, sliced green onions, chopped cilantro, and lime juice. Season lightly with salt to taste. Mix until combined.

  2. 5

    Assemble base layers

    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Spread the creamy salsa mixture evenly in an ovenproof shallow baking dish (a 9-inch round or 9x6-inch oval works well), creating a smooth layer about 1/2–3/4 inch thick. Spoon the warm seasoned beef-and-vegetable mixture evenly over the creamy layer and gently spread to cover it completely.

Cheese Topping & Bake

  1. 6

    Top with cheese

    Evenly sprinkle the 2 cups shredded Tex-Mex cheese over the beef layer. If using, scatter crumbled queso fresco or cotija sparingly on top.

  2. 7

    Bake to melt

    Place the assembled dip in the preheated oven and b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the cheese is fully melted and bubbling at the edges. For a browned top, switch oven to broil for 1–2 minutes while watching closely to avoid burning.

  3. 8

    Finish and garnish

    Remove from oven and let rest 3–5 minutes. Sprinkle sliced green onions and cilantro leaves over the hot cheese. Add pickled jalapeños on top if using. Taste and adjust any final salt or lime if desired.

To Serve

  1. 9

    Serve the Nacho Delight Dip hot with large sturdy nacho chips on the side for scooping. Recommend providing extra napkins; this dip is best enjoyed fresh and warm. Leftovers can be refrigerated in an airtight container for up to 3 days and reheated in a 350°F (175°C) oven until warmed through.
